Dolly Parton's Business Acumen and Philanthropy Highlighted

Dolly Parton's entrepreneurial success, including her theme park resort, has been highlighted as a significant source of her wealth, often eclipsing her musical earnings. Her business ventures have also supported extensive philanthropic efforts.

Dolly Parton's entrepreneurial achievements are a significant aspect of her career, with her business acumen arguably eclipsing her musical talent as a source of wealth. Her theme park resort, Dollywood, has been identified as the largest contributor to her fortune.

Parton's business ventures began early; at 20, she founded her music company, Owe-Par, to retain ownership of her catalogue. A notable decision was her refusal to relinquish half the publishing rights for her song "I Will Always Love You" to Elvis Presley, a move that proved financially savvy when Whitney Houston's cover generated over $10 million in royalties in the 1990s alone.

By 2025, Parton's net worth was estimated at nearly half a billion dollars. Beyond her commercial success, Parton has used her wealth for philanthropic initiatives. The Imagination Library, a literacy scheme she established in 1995, has distributed over 33 million free books globally. In 2020, she funded early research for the Moderna vaccine, and in Sevier County, Tennessee, she is credited with reducing the school dropout rate from 35 per cent to six per cent by pledging $500 to every graduating student.
